auto to manual conversion complete, but having some issues
hey guys i am posting again, i really need some advice
i just finished the conversion this past weekend
just having an issue getting the car started.
i changed the auto ecu with a manual ecu
when i put the key in the ignition the cluster registers its in the "D" drive position
when i crank it i only hear on click
can it be the starter or do i have to re-wire something?
also i dont know if it matters mut i am still using the auto ground wire

did you ground out the neutral safety switch? If you didn't i'd bet that's your problem, especailly if it thinks your in drive.

thanks for the quick reply
is the neutral saftey switch on the clutch pedal?
if so i wired those up to the old auto harness in the shifter console.
if not can you clarify on the location, i dont have the helms manual in front of me.
i did more searching and found some info.
basically it said to hook up the old auto slider and put the car in park
then start it. I will try this later tonite.

It's the part on the tranny that tells the car what gear it's in. So you basicly have to trick it into thinking it's in park.
